I think what "Thomas" is saying is he can't save pdf files, not the
download of Reader. And it seems it's easier in 6.0 to save than it
was in earlier versions.
Thomas, there should be a button on the topleft of the screen that
says "Save a Copy" with the disk icon. Perhaps your download
wasn't complete or is corrupt? I got my copy from a CD, so didn't
have to pick and choose and risk having the download interrupted.
Also, you can always right click on the pdf file before opening it and
choose "Save Target As" and open it at your leisure.
